Understanding the Costs of Chain Link Fencing Chain link fencing is a popular choice for homeowners and businesses looking for an economical and durable fencing solution. Its versatility, ease of installation, and low maintenance make it a contender for various security needs. However, understanding the costs associated with chain link fencing can be essential for budgeting and decision-making. Factors Influencing Chain Link Fence Costs 1. Material Quality The cost of chain link fencing is largely determined by the quality of materials used. Standard galvanized steel chain link fencing is the most common and generally the most affordable. However, options like vinyl-coated chain link or stainless steel come at a premium. Vinyl-coated fences provide additional aesthetics and corrosion resistance, potentially increasing installation costs. 2. Height and Gauge The height and gauge (thickness) of the chain link also play a significant role in determining the price. Standard heights range from 3 to 12 feet, with taller fences typically costing more. Additionally, the gauge of the wire can impact strength and durability. A lower gauge number indicates a thicker wire, which generally costs more but offers greater durability. 3. Length of Fence The total length of the fence required for your project is a primary cost factor. Lengthy installations will require more materials and therefore, lead to higher overall costs. It’s important to accurately measure your property’s perimeter before engaging in your fencing project, as miscalculations can lead to unnecessary expenses. 4. Installation Costs If you choose to hire professionals for installation, labor costs can significantly impact your budget. Professional installers charge based on the project size, complexity, and local market rates. For DIY enthusiasts, installing a chain link fence can save on costs, but it requires tools and some basic skills to ensure proper installation. black chain link fence cost 5. Accessories and Features Additional features such as gates, post caps, and privacy slats can also add to the overall cost of a chain link fencing project. Gates vary widely in price depending on their size and locking mechanisms. Privacy slats, which enhance the visual appeal of chain link fences while providing additional privacy, can add both material and labor costs. 6. Permitting and Location Local regulations may necessitate permits for installing fences, which can incur added costs. Additionally, your location can impact costs due to variations in labor rates, material availability, and transportation costs. Average Costs On average, homeowners can expect to spend between $10 to $20 per linear foot for a standard chain link fence, including both materials and installation. For more premium options like vinyl-coated fencing, costs can rise to $20 to $30 per linear foot. The overall budget can thus vary widely based on the aforementioned factors.
